The Challenge: The Crippling Cost and Risk of Manual Compliance

For financial institutions and global enterprises, manual compliance processes are a multi-million-dollar liability. This section explores how immutable on-chain transaction records transform a cost center into a strategic asset.

The current state of compliance is a manual, error-prone nightmare. Teams spend thousands of hours annually reconciling payments, chasing counterparties for documentation, and preparing for audits. A single cross-border transaction can generate a paper trail across a dozen internal systems, creating a fragmented audit trail that is expensive to assemble and easy to challenge. The risk isn't just cost; it's regulatory exposure. Inconsistent records can lead to failed audits, hefty fines, and severe reputational damage, turning compliance from a business function into a business threat.

Blockchain introduces a single source of truth for payment provenance. By recording transaction metadata—amounts, timestamps, participant identities, and regulatory flags—directly onto an immutable ledger, you create an indisputable audit trail. This isn't just a digital log; it's a cryptographically sealed record that every permissioned party can trust without manual verification. The result is a dramatic reduction in the cost of reconciliation and dispute resolution. Auditors can be granted read-only access to a complete, real-time history, turning a weeks-long evidence-gathering process into a simple API query.

The Future State: Programmable Compliance

Move beyond recording to automating compliance logic. Smart contracts can be encoded with regulatory rules (e.g., sanctions lists, tax thresholds) to:

  • Auto-flag non-compliant transactions before execution.
  • Dynamically generate and store compliance reports.
  • Enable real-time regulatory reporting via permissioned data feeds.

This transforms compliance from a cost center to a strategic, automated business function.

Immutable Clinical Trial Data Integrity

Pharma compliance (FDA 21 CFR Part 11) requires proving data hasn't been altered. On-chain data hashing creates a permanent, timestamped fingerprint for every patient record and trial result.

  • Provides regulators with verifiable proof of data integrity from collection to submission.
  • Automates audit trails for patient consent forms and protocol adherence.
